40. Papua New Guinea to Invest in Tourism Growth
The Prime Minister of Papua New Guinea, Peter O'Neill has unveiled plans to invest K10 million per year over the next five years into global tourism campaigns designed to boost Papua New Guineas international visitor arrival numbers.
